What Are Bytes and Why Are They Important?
A byte is one of the fundamental units of digital information in computing and telecommunications. It consists of 8 bits and is used to encode a single character of text in most computer systems. Bytes are the building blocks of all digital data, whether it’s a song, a photo, or an application. Understanding bytes is essential because they form the basis of data measurement and storage.
Bytes are important because they allow us to quantify data in a standardized way. For instance, when you download a file, its size is often represented in bytes or its higher multiples like kilobytes (KB), megabytes (MB), or gigabytes (GB). This standardization makes it easier to manage and compare data across systems.

What Is a Megabyte?
A megabyte (MB) is a unit of digital information that is equal to 1,000,000 bytes in the decimal system or 1,048,576 bytes in the binary system. It is commonly used to represent file sizes, storage capacities, and data transfer rates. The term "megabyte" is derived from the Greek word "mega," meaning "large," and "byte," the unit of digital data.
Megabytes are often used in the context of computer storage, internet data plans, and software applications. For example, a high-resolution photo might be 5 MB, while a standard MP3 song could be around 3 MB. How to Convert Bytes to Megabytes?
Converting bytes to megabytes is a straightforward process that involves dividing the number of bytes by the appropriate conversion factor. The factor depends on whether you are using the decimal or binary system:
- Decimal System: Divide the number of bytes by 1,000,000 (106).
- Binary System: Divide the number of bytes by 1,048,576 (220).
For instance, if you have a file size of 5,000,000 bytes and want to convert it to megabytes using the decimal system, the calculation would be:
5,000,000 ÷ 1,000,000 = 5 MB
Similarly, using the binary system:
5,000,000 ÷ 1,048,576 ≈ 4.77 MB
Bytes to Megabytes Conversion Formula
The formula for converting bytes to megabytes depends on the system you are using:
- Decimal System:Megabytes = Bytes ÷ 1,000,000
- Binary System:Megabytes = Bytes ÷ 1,048,576
These formulas are essential for accurate conversions, whether you are calculating storage requirements for a project or analyzing data usage.
Bytes to Megabytes Conversion Chart
Here is a quick reference chart to make bytes to megabytes conversion easier:
Bytes | Megabytes (Decimal) | Megabytes (Binary) |
---|---|---|
1,000 | 0.001 MB | 0.00095367 MB |
1,000,000 | 1 MB | 0.95367 MB |
10,000,000 | 10 MB | 9.5367 MB |
1,000,000,000 | 1,000 MB | 953.67 MB |

How Many Bytes Are in a Megabyte?
In the decimal system, there are 1,000,000 bytes in a megabyte. However, in the binary system, a megabyte contains 1,048,576 bytes. These differences arise from the way each system defines data units:
- Decimal System: Commonly used in marketing and storage devices.
- Binary System: Preferred in technical and computing contexts.

Bytes vs. Bits: What You Need to Know
While bytes and bits are both units of digital information, they serve different purposes:
- Bytes: Represent larger data sizes, used for storage and files.
- Bits: Smaller unit, often used for data transfer rates (e.g., Mbps).

Frequently Asked Questions About Bytes to Megabytes
Q: What is the difference between MB and MiB?
A: MB (megabyte) follows the decimal system (1,000,000 bytes), while MiB (mebibyte) uses the binary system (1,048,576 bytes).
Q: Why do storage devices use the decimal system?
A: Manufacturers use the decimal system because it aligns with marketing metrics and is simpler for consumers to understand.
